FYI, we noticed the below changes on
https://git.kernel.org/pub/scm/linux/kernel/git/next/linux-next.git master
commit 68c3a763cd182bbfdcb4bdd4561776c87158a6cc ("mm: add tracepoint for scanning
pages")
+------------------------------------------------+------------+------------+
| | f46465d797 | 68c3a763cd |
+------------------------------------------------+------------+------------+
| boot_successes | 11 | 11 |
| boot_failures | 20 | 20 |
| IP-Config:Auto-configuration_of_network_failed | 20 | 1 |
| BUG:unable_to_handle_kernel | 0 | 19 |
| Oops | 0 | 19 |
| RIP:khugepaged_scan_mm_slot | 0 | 19 |
| Kernel_panic-not_syncing:Fatal_exception | 0 | 19 |
| backtrace:khugepaged | 0 | 19 |
+------------------------------------------------+------------+------------+
[ 14.453377] systemd-journald[140]: Vacuuming...
[ 14.454029] systemd-journald[140]: Vacuuming done, freed 0 bytes
[ 14.455092] systemd-journald[140]: Flushing /dev/kmsg...
[ 14.456250] BUG: unable to handle kernel NULL pointer dereference at (null)
[ 14.457208] IP: [<ffffffff81165eb9>] khugepaged_scan_mm_slot+0x3f9/0x1490
[ 14.457208] PGD 0
[ 14.457208] Oops: 0000 [#1] PREEMPT
[ 14.457208] CPU: 0 PID: 17 Comm: khugepaged Not tainted 4.3.0-rc1-00110-g68c3a76 #1
[ 14.457208] task: ffff88013a94d300 ti: ffff88013a960000 task.ti: ffff88013a960000
[ 14.457208] RIP: 0010:[<ffffffff81165eb9>] [<ffffffff81165eb9>]
khugepaged_scan_mm_slot+0x3f9/0x1490
[ 14.457208] RSP: 0000:ffff88013a963ce8 EFLAGS: 00010246
[ 14.457208] RAX: 0000000000000000 RBX: 0000000000000000 RCX: 000000007fe7b000
[ 14.457208] RDX: 0000000000000000 RSI: ffff880000000c88 RDI: 0000000000000000
[ 14.457208] RBP: ffff88013a963de0 R08: ffff880000000000 R09: 0000000000000000
[ 14.457208] R10: 0000000000000000 R11: 0000000000000000 R12: 0000000000000002
[ 14.457208] R13: 0000000000000000 R14: ffff88007f068000 R15: ffff88007f068000
[ 14.457208] FS: 0000000000000000(0000) GS:ffffffff81864000(0000)
knlGS:0000000000000000
[ 14.457208] CS: 0010 DS: 0000 ES: 0000 CR0: 000000008005003b
[ 14.457208] CR2: 0000000000000000 CR3: 000000007f045000 CR4: 00000000000006b0
[ 14.457208] Stack:
[ 14.457208] 00000000004352da 0000000000000046 00000000000001c1 ffff88013a963de0
[ 14.457208] ffffffff811262b9 0000000000000000 0000000000000000 0000000000000000
[ 14.457208] ffff88013a94d9f0 ffff88013a963e10 ffff88013a94d300 ffff88013a94d300
[ 14.457208] Call Trace:
[ 14.457208] [<ffffffff811262b9>] ? __alloc_pages_nodemask+0x119/0x8e0
[ 14.457208] [<ffffffff8116704b>] ? khugepaged+0xfb/0x5a0
[ 14.457208] [<ffffffff8116737c>] khugepaged+0x42c/0x5a0
[ 14.457208] [<ffffffff810a09c0>] ? __wake_up_common+0x90/0x90
[ 14.457208] [<ffffffff81166f50>] ? khugepaged_scan_mm_slot+0x1490/0x1490
[ 14.457208] [<ffffffff810915e6>] kthread+0x106/0x120
[ 14.457208] [<ffffffff810914e0>] ? __kthread_parkme+0xb0/0xb0
[ 14.457208] [<ffffffff815a005f>] ret_from_fork+0x3f/0x70
[ 14.457208] [<ffffffff810914e0>] ? __kthread_parkme+0xb0/0xb0
[ 14.457208] Code: 2d ad 3a 82 00 0f 86 2f ff ff ff 44 89 6d d0 48 89 f3 49 89 f5 41 bc
03 00 00 00 48 8b 7d b8 e8 9e 92 43 00 c7 45 b8 00 00 00 00 <49> 8b 45 00 48 c1 e8
2d 48 89 c2 48 c1 ea 07 48 8b 14 d5 00 63
[ 14.457208] RIP [<ffffffff81165eb9>] khugepaged_scan_mm_slot+0x3f9/0x1490
[ 14.457208] RSP <ffff88013a963ce8>
[ 14.457208] CR2: 0000000000000000
[ 14.457208] ---[ end trace 633a5342912b683c ]---
[ 14.457208] Kernel panic - not syncing: Fatal exception
Thanks,
Ying Huang